What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ates near the B train in NYC

  • Use the B-train proximity filter to focus your search on commutable options, then sort by the lowest open violation rates available on each building page.
  • Confirm details with the management office: whether maintenance issues are currently addressed, and how often inspections and repairs are completed.
  • If you’re planning to move soon, check current availability on Openigloo so you can line up showings and applications around your timeline.
  • Ask about lease mechanics and fees that can affect your total monthly cost, including deposits and any move-in charges beyond rent.
  • Treat open-violation data as a starting point. A “low” rate doesn’t guarantee a unit has no current problems; ask about the specific unit you’re considering.
